They sent someone out who took pictures.  They then informed me that it didn't meet the normal wear and tear and they wouldn't support the warranty and recommended I call the extended warranty company - Guardsman.  I did just that and printed out the paper work they requested, filled it out and sent pictures of the damage.  They also denied my claim stating that I hadn't submitted my clain within 10 days of noting the damage.  I tried to explain that I first contacted Ashley and at their instruction waited for their notification to see if the frame and springs would be repaird.  It didn't matter, they still denied the claim.  (The damage was that the wood to support the middle couch was not made out of heavy 2 x 4 but rather just plywood and had broken in the middle.)
I then wrote a letter to Ashley Corporate Headquarters, as well as Guardsman Corporate Headquarters.  I was contacted by a supervisor at Ashley Corporate who had spoken with Guardsman and she stated that even if I did meet their timeframe cut-off the damage was not covered by their warranty either.
I will never purchase another item by Ashley again as their quality and is poor and they do not stand behind their products and warranties.

Sectional was broken on delivery but covered up by delivery men.  First repair was within two weeks.  Within six months one arm started popping when leaned on.  Called in for second repair.  Repair appt. was cancelled three times on their end.  Finally when they came to fix it I took a peak at the interior of the arm, it was made with CARDBOARD and wood slats spaced about a foot apart.  When I mentioned it to the repair man he said, "but it's really good cardboard!"  Now about 10 months in the springs are starting to sag and I feel like I'm sitting on the floor.  Money down the drain.
